@Red H: MDF base, wooden rods structure, covered in translucent paper (tracing paper?), two alternative poster board back drops (black and a light, neutral, grey). For lightning, I've been using my workbench lamps, two - one on each side - articulated, long armed desk lamps, with high power equivalent (100 or 120 W) daylight bulbs. I'd wanted to make one for a while, had though of a foldable one (less cluttering of the shop if it were easy to put away, got tired of my "temporary" arrangement, so just put it together as is.
